
The Bachelor Girl(1929)
The Bachelor Girl Synopsis
Joyce (Jacqueline Logan), a beautiful and efficient secretary, does her best to take in hand and reform shiftless stock clerk Jimmy (William Colllier, Jr.), with whom she is in love. Despite her tireless efforts, he continues on his downward path. They separate, only to meet a couple of years later, at which point he vows to make himself worthy of her.
The Bachelor Girl (1929) is a drama and romance film directed by Richard Thorpe, released on May 20, 1929 with a runtime of 1h 6m. It stars William Collier Jr., Jacqueline Logan, Edward Hearn and Thelma Todd. Viewers rate it 7.0 out of 10 across 1 ratings.
